Table 1. Demographic, clinical and fluid status data of the EuroBCM study cohort (N = 639).

mean or percentage Standard deviation
Gender Male 55%
Age (years) 58.8 14.8
Height (cm) 165.7 9.6
Weight (kg) 72.2 15.4
Body Mass Index (kg/m2) 26.3 5.1
Blood pressure (mmHg) Systolic Diastolic 136.979.9 25.614.3
Residual GFR (ml/min) 6.6 7.2
Ultrafiltration (ml/day) 940 580
Residual urine output <100 ml/day 100–500 ml/day 500–1000 ml/day >1000 ml/day Missing data 19.1%21.9%23.5%32.6%3.0%
Treatment modality Automated PD § 53.1%
Use of polyglucose § 63.7%
Transport status Fast Fast average Slow average Slow Not known 16.6%33.3%28.3%5.9%15.9%
Serum levels Albumin (g/l) Creatinine (mg/dl) Urea (mg/dl) C-reactiveprotein (mg/l) Hemoglobin (g/dl) Hematocrit (%) HbA1C (%) 36.38.1117.011.611.334.36.5 6.03.039.723.51.65.11.7
Absolute ΔTissue Hydration (AΔTH) (l) 1.7Q25: 0.2; Median 1.3; Q75: 2.9 2.3
Relative ΔTissue Hydration (%) (Ratio AΔTH/ECW) 8.6Q25: 1.1; Median 7.8; Q75: 15.1 11.5
Total Body Water (l) 35.8 7.7
Extracellular Water (l) 17.2 3.8
Intracellular water (l) 18.5 4.5
Extracellular/Intracellular water 0.95 0.15
Intracellular resistance Ri (Ohm/m) 569.6 117.5
Extracellular resistance Re (Ohm/m) 1611.6 479.5
Phase angle at 50 kHz 4.9 1.2
§

after exclusion of patients from countries where polyglucose and APD are not liberally available due to logistical reasons.
